Learn WebAssembly by writing small programs

This page summarizes the projects mentioned and recommended in the original post on news.ycombinator.com

Our great sponsors
  • WorkOS - The modern identity platform for B2B SaaS
  • InfluxDB - Power Real-Time Data Analytics at Scale
  • SaaSHub - Software Alternatives and Reviews
  • watlings

    Learn WebAssembly by writing small programs!

  • It credits Rustlings at the end of the page linked to (https://github.com/EmNudge/watlings#credits).

  • rustlings-solutions-5

    Rustlings 5 (5.2.1) Solutions

  • i think you've found what i'm looking for! https://github.com/rust-lang/rustlings

  • WorkOS

    The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.

    WorkOS logo
  • MicroPyScript

    Discontinued MicroPyScript: A test harness for multiple runtimes in PyScript

  • > And currently using anything but C, C++ or Rust isn't feasible

    Someone should tell Anaconda that they can't do this, then: https://pyscript.net/

  • wasm-wat-samples

    Samples of WebAssembly Text programs

  • Cool project!

    I maintain a somewhat related repo here: https://github.com/eliben/wasm-wat-samples/

  • proposals

    Tracking WebAssembly proposals (by WebAssembly)

  • GC proposal is from 2018: https://github.com/WebAssembly/proposals/issues/16 and there’s code: https://github.com/WebAssembly/gc/blob/master/proposals/gc/O...

    Seems like an awefully long time for progress to be made, given all the possibilities it would unlock.

  • gc

    Branch of the spec repo scoped to discussion of GC integration in WebAssembly

  • GC proposal is from 2018: https://github.com/WebAssembly/proposals/issues/16 and there’s code: https://github.com/WebAssembly/gc/blob/master/proposals/gc/O...

    Seems like an awefully long time for progress to be made, given all the possibilities it would unlock.

N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a more popular project.

Suggest a related project

Related posts